It throws all Epic’s new Unreal Engine 5 tech together in something that starts out with just cinematics, but does indeed morph into something playable
This part is pretty impressive on its own, but it’s what came after this that blew me away. Once the chase scene wraps, you’re taken to a free roam version of the cityscape, where you can either walk around on foot like you would in a GTA game, or you can use a drone mode to fly around. It’s a sprawling sandbox, a truly massive space that is way, way bigger than I imagined it would be, and I have really no idea how this entire massive space was built for a single tech demo.
The visuals here are like nothing I’ve ever seen before, and shows how it’s not just your hardware that’s creating top-notch graphics, it’s the evolution of game engines themselves, and what Epic has done here with Unreal Engine 5 is nothing short of a digital miracle in many ways. Photorealistic Keanu is one thing, but thisis just incredible, I’ve never seen anything like it in a playable space. Digital CG for movie special effects? Sure, maybe, but nothing you can actively explore.
